Case Study: Controversial Cartoons

About This Lesson

In light of attack on the Paris offices of the satirical newspaper Charlie Hebdo, we are sharing a case study on editorial cartoons of the prophet Muhammad from one of our journalism ethics museum classes. Current events case studies are used in our classes to discuss ethical issues journalists and photojournalists face on a daily basis.
